Output 8d121a4bc5d176d4d2f2ec6852e99058840b9f2a3b0654b794a1e7673a23a207:0

value
2920000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ba6e87c5f32c9325b2268220b72ae6c18416182e OP_EQUAL
address
3Jgn21T2dcXJYkXHHmg6JjPbdQCgyWqPNV
transaction
8d121a4bc5d176d4d2f2ec6852e99058840b9f2a3b0654b794a1e7673a23a207
spent
true